They said Quests from the Infinite Staircase is a collection of updated older adventures a la Yawning Portal and Saltmarsh, but I don't know that they're necessarily going to be the same adventures from 2e's Tales from the Infinite Staircase.

I wouldn't be surprised if the anthology included one adventure per major TSR/WotC setting (likely omitting Birthright, Jakandor, Council of Wyrms, Dark Sun, and a few others), thereby extending that grand tour of the multiverse that the new Vecna adventure is hinting at. So I would expect reprints/updates of adventures set in FR, Greyhawk, Mystara, Eberron, Krynn, Blackmoor (?), Ravenloft, Spelljammer, and/or Planescape. Perhaps the scenarios will be selected specifically so that they can be slotted in as side quests for the main Vecna campaign?
